2/18/2011
The state of Pennsylvania has initiated a campaign to help tobacco users quit smoking. Over the next six to eight months, more than $300,000 worth of nicotine replacement therapy kits will be distributed free to Pennsylvania residents age 18 and older. The state's Quit for Love smoking-cessation program is funded through federal stimulus money and money from tobacco companies.
Source: York Dispatch
